Former Super Eagles defender Taribo West has praised the growth of defender William Troost-Ekong following his move to Italy, where he has become a regular at Serie A side Udinese.


Ekong joined Udinese from Turkish side Bursaspor two weeks ago and he has played in their last two games with his performances drawing him praises for the way he has settled down to the demands of Italian football.


West who played for Inter-Milan and later AC Milan in Italy said Ekong has matured superbly the past two years, something he expected on loan Chelsea defender Kenneth Omeruo to achieve when he broke into the national team in 2013.

” The way Ekong has progressed is impressive. It shows he is learning very quick. Playing regularly in the Serie A is not an easy feat. Let us hope he continue to progress because it will benefit the Super Eagles more “, West told Owngoalnigeria.com.


” I think we expected so much from Omeruo when he first came to the team and one would have thought his career will progress like what Ekong is having now. Omeruo still has age on his side despite the slow growth”.
